随着区块链技术的迅猛发展,越来越多的企业和个人开始关注这一新兴技术。而在众多的区块链平台中,Ethereum(以太坊)、Bitcoin(比特币)和Hyperledger因其独特的特性和广泛的应用,成为了三大主要平台。在本文中,我们将深入探讨这三大区块链平台的优缺点,以及它们在不同场景下的应用潜力。
一、Ethereum(以太坊)
Ethereum,是一个开源的区块链平台,具有智能合约功能。它于2015年正式上线,创始人为Vitalik Buterin。在Ethereum平台上,开发者可以创建和部署自己的去中心化应用(DApps),这是其相较于其他平台的最大优势之一。
Ethereum的核心特性包括:
- 智能合约:智能合约是一种自动化合约,其条款直接写入代码中。通过智能合约,交易可以由计算机程序自动执行,减少人为干预。
- 去中心化应用(DApps):以太坊允许开发者构建各种去中心化应用,从游戏到金融服务,应用范围广泛。
- ERC-20标准:Ethereum支持多种代币的创建,ERC-20标准使得代币间的互操作性更强,促进了代币经济的发展。
然而,Ethereum也存在一定的不足:
- 扩展性随着使用人数的增加,Ethereum网络可能会面临交易拥堵和高额手续费的问题。
- 能源消耗:Ethereum在其未转向权益证明(PoS)共识机制之前,使用了工作量证明(PoW),因此消耗大量能源。
二、Bitcoin(比特币)
比特币是由中本聪于2009年推出的第一个区块链平台。作为全球第一个去中心化的数字货币,比特币不仅是一种付款手段,还引发了对区块链技术的广泛关注。
比特币的主要优势在于:
- 去中心化:比特币网络不受任何中央控制机构约束,用户可以在没有中介的情况下进行交易。
- 安全性高:比特币的工作量证明机制确保了交易的安全性,防止了双重花费问题。
- 数字货币的先锋:比特币引领了全球数字货币的浪潮,在市场上具有最高的认可度和流通性。
然而,比特币也有其短板:
- 交易速度慢:比特币的区块生成时间约为10分钟,这意味着交易的处理速度相对慢。这让比特币在日常小额支付上表现不佳。
- 规模限制:比特币的交易处理能力有限,无法满足大规模交易的需求。
三、Hyperledger
Hyperledger并不是一个单一的区块链,它是由Linux基金会管理的一个跨行业的开源项目,旨在推进区块链技术在企业中的应用。Hyperledger包括多个不同的项目,如Hyperledger Fabric、Sawtooth和Iroha等。
Hyperledger的显著特点是:
- 企业导向:Hyperledger专注于提供可扩展且高效的区块链解决方案,适合企业的商业需求。
- 私有链支持:Hyperledger允许创建私有链,提供更好的隐私和数据控制,适合企业内部使用。
- 灵活性高:不同的Hyperledger项目提供多种技术栈供开发者选择,满足不同的业务需求。
但Hyperledger也并非没有缺陷:
- 学习曲线陡峭:由于其复杂性,开发人员在使用Hyperledger平台时可能需要较长的学习时间。
- 生态系统较小:与Ethereum和Bitcoin相比,Hyperledger的生态系统仍在逐步发展。
相关问题分析
1. 区块链平台的选择标准是什么?
选择合适的区块链平台是一个复杂的过程,主要依据以下几个标准:
- 用例需求:了解业务需求是选择合适平台的首要步骤。不同平台在处理不同场景的效率和效果可能差异显著。例如,如果需要创建智能合约和去中心化应用,Ethereum是一个理想之选;而对于需要企业级应用的场景,Hyperledger将更为合适。
- 安全性:区块链的安全性是技术选择的重要标准。用户需要评估平台的安全机制,如共识算法是否足够可靠,确保交易的安全性。
- 可扩展性:可扩展性指的是平台在高负载下仍能稳定处理交易的能力。选定平台时,必须考虑其在用户增加后的表现。
- 社区支持与开发资源:一个活跃的开发者社区通常意味着平台将获得更频繁的更新与支持,同时可能有更多的开发文档和教程支持新用户学习。
- 成本因素:有些平台可能在交易费用或运行成本方面有明显差异。企业在选择时应确保费用结构适合其预算。
最终的选择过程需要综合考虑上述因素,并进行详细的市场调研,以认可和适应快速发展的区块链领域。
2. 区块链技术如何改变产业结构?
区块链技术的广泛应用正迅速改变各个行业的运作方式,在多个层面上重新定义产业结构。以下是一些显著变化:
- 提高透明度:区块链技术通过其去中心化和不可篡改的特性,提高了供应链的透明度。企业能够实时追踪产品从生产到销售的每一个环节,提高信任度,减少欺诈行为。
- 降低成本:通过去除中介和简化流程,企业可以显著降低交易成本。例如,金融行业的跨境支付可以通过区块链直接实现,避免传统银行的高额费用。
- 加速交易流程:区块链可以实现实时交易,特别是在金融服务方面,有助于提升结算速度。
- 促成新商业模式:区块链的去中心化特性使得社区驱动的商业模式成为可能,比如去中心化金融(DeFi),为创业者提供了新的机会。
总之,区块链技术正在深刻影响着产链的每一个环节,使得各行业能够实现更高效率和更良好的客户体验。
3. 区块链在金融行业的应用现状如何?
区块链正通过智能合约、加密货币和多种去中心化金融应用(DeFi)深入改变金融行业。这里是一些关键的应用现状:
- 跨境支付:区块链帮助金融机构实现快速低成本的跨境支付,像Ripple等公司已经推出得到了广泛应用的解决方案。传输时间从几天减少到几秒钟,费用也显著降低。
- 去中心化金融(DeFi):DeFi平台提供了传统金融服务的去中心化替代方案,包括借贷、交易、收益农场等。这使得用户可以不再依赖传统银行,通过智能合约直接在区块链上进行金融交易。
- 资产数字化:实体资产如房地产、艺术品等通过tokenization可以在区块链上进行交易,提高流动性及降低进入门槛。
- 监管合规:区块链为金融机构提供了高效的方式来确保合规与透明性,提升反洗钱(AML)和了解你的客户(KYC)流程的效率。
尽管区块链在金融领域展现出巨大的潜力,但仍面临许多挑战,包括法律监管、技术成熟度以及公众接受度等。
4. 区块链在未来可能发展方向?
展望未来,区块链技术可能在以下几个方向进一步发展:
- 多链互操作性:未来会有更多的努力旨在提高不同区块链之间的互操作性,以方便用户在不同平台间自由移动资产。
- 更高效的共识机制:随着对环境友好型解决方案的需求增加,将有更多区块链项目开始寻找性能与效率的平衡,朝着使用权益证明(PoS)和其他新型共识机制的方向发展。
- 隐私保护技术:在数据隐私成为越来越重要的背景下,隐私保护型区块链(如零知识证明等技术)的应用将得到更大的推广。
- 政府监管政策:各国政府对于区块链和数字货币的态度正在逐渐趋向规范化。未来,监管将更为健全,有助于区块链整体生态的健康发展。
总之,区块链技术的前景光明,随着技术的成熟和应用模式的不断创新,未来的区块链将更广泛地渗透到我们的生活中。尽管面临许多挑战,但各方都在为应对这些挑战而努力,推动区块链技术不断前进。
本文希望帮助读者更全面地理解区块链三大平台的特点、应用及未来发展,同时期望能够提供一些思考和借鉴,引导读者在这个技术迅速发展的时代更好地进行决策。